Sedation-Free Pediatric Neuroimaging with Deep Learning-Reconstructed Deep Resolve 3D MR Sequences by Bac Nguyen (Oslo Universitetssykehus, Rikshospitalet, Oslo, Norway). In pediatric neuroimaging, sedation or general anesthesia are often used during MRI exams to help young patients stay still. However, emerging AI-based techniques β such as deep-learning (DL)-based image reconstruction β contribute to faster scans, reducing the need for sedation. Faster scans reduce motion artifacts, improve image quality, and increase the likelihood of successful awake MRI scans. Deep Resolve is currently available for 2D sequences, and has been highly beneficial. Yet, most neuro protocols include both 2D and 3D sequences. The two most commonly used and time-consuming 3D sequences are T1w 3D MPRAGE and T2w 3D SPACE FLAIR. Applying DL-based reconstruction to these 3D sequences holds great promise for cases where patients struggle to tolerate longer scan times. In this article, Bac Nguyen shares early insights using research versions of 3D MPRAGE and 3D FLAIR with Deep Resolve.
